首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>OpenCV: Framebuffer in 5-6-5,如何在Mat中加载?

OpenCV: Framebuffer in 5-6-5,如何在Mat中加载?
EN

Stack Overflow用户
提问于 2011-11-10 11:02:25
回答 1查看 812关注 0票数 0

我正在尝试使用OpenCV对图像进行一些操作。

我正在接收RGB 5-6-5的图像流,我想将它们顺时针旋转90度,逆时针旋转90度。

我已经写了代码来转换它从RGB5-6-5到ARGB8-8-8-8 (32位),以便我可以加载到CV_8UC4的垫,但旋转后,它看起来有点抖动。

有谁有一个好的解决方案,我可以旋转一个5-6-5图像吗?我总是旋转90度或-90度(宽度变成高度,反之亦然),所以我应该保持相同的质量。

非常感谢。

编辑:

我找到了一个很好的解决方案:选择CV_16UC1就行了。然后,我可以执行一个转置(),然后是一个翻转()。就像一种护身符!

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2011-11-13 03:29:37

我找到了一个很好的解决方案:选择CV_16UC1就行了。然后,我可以执行一个转置(),然后是一个翻转()。就像一种护身符!

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/8074513

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档